European Wages and Salaries in Plumbing, Heat and Air Conditioning Installation by Country

In 2023, Germany leads European wages in plumbing, heat, and air conditioning installation with 12.88 billion euros, exhibiting a 6.37% increase. France follows with 9.1 billion euros and a modest 1.69% growth. The UK reports 3.9 billion euros with a meager 0.53% rise. Italy and the Netherlands show close values, but the Netherlands experienced a notable 7.26% surge. Poland and Serbia saw the highest relative growth at 14.48% and 14.94% respectively. Meanwhile, Ireland and Greece witnessed declines, exhibiting -7.13% and -1.97%. Bulgaria and Cyprus remain near the lower end with marginal increases.
